Abstract (EN)
Existence and morality, as separate fields, are the most fundamental subjects of philosophy. These areas have been talked about since ancient times and various ideas have emerged. All these ideas come from man's attempt to make sense of life. This effort reveals the intersection point of ontology and ethics. That is to say, existence and morality are closely related to each other in this sense. When it comes to existence, not only particular materials, but also entities such as humans, God, and the universe come to mind. Therefore, our relationship with existence is one of the factors that determine our life algorithm. How should we live? We also derive the codes of our answer to this question from our understanding of existence at the philosophical level. Existentialism focuses on humans and their search for meaning in general. It is a philosophical movement that tries to find a way to live, and it is about morality. The aim of this study is to examine in a coherence, by focusing on non-theist existential philosophers, Heidegger, Sartre and Camus, about how to establish morality without adopting a God, their achievements and evaluations without comparing them. In the first part of our study, the problem is revealed by focusing on approaches to the issue of morality, religion and God, and by expressing the existentialism in a basic sense. In the second part, philosophers' understanding of existence take place and in the third part, related to this understanding, their speeches about morality are included. By evaluating their differences, their similarities, what they tell us and their approach to morality, it has been tried to reveal in this study whether a human-based understanding of morality can be a solution to today's moral impasse.
